Embracing Policy Issuance Automation: A Path to Efficiency and Precision in Insurance

The insurance industry is constantly evolving, with new technologies and innovations emerging to streamline processes and enhance customer experiences. One area that has witnessed significant advancements is policy issuance automation, which involves the automation of data entry, validation, and document generation for new insurance policies.

Challenges of Policy Issuance in Insurance

Traditionally, policy issuance was a manual, time-consuming process prone to errors. This inefficiency not only delayed policy delivery but also increased the risk of inaccuracies, potentially leading to disputes and dissatisfied customers. To address these challenges, insurance companies are turning to Python, AI, and cloud-based solutions for automation.

Benefits of Policy Issuance Automation

By automating policy issuance, insurance companies can reap numerous benefits, including:

  • Reduced processing time: Automation eliminates the need for manual data entry and validation, significantly reducing the time it takes to issue a policy.
  • Enhanced accuracy: Automated systems minimize the risk of human errors, ensuring that policies are issued correctly and consistently.
  • Improved customer satisfaction: Faster policy issuance and reduced errors lead to increased customer satisfaction and loyalty.
  • Cost savings: Automation reduces the need for manual labor, freeing up resources for other value-added tasks and reducing overall operating costs.

The Role of Python, AI, and Cloud in Policy Issuance Automation

Python, AI, and cloud-based solutions play a crucial role in policy issuance automation. Python’s versatility and extensive libraries make it ideal for automating data entry and validation tasks. AI algorithms can assist in underwriting decisions and risk assessment, ensuring accurate policy issuance. Cloud-based platforms provide the necessary infrastructure and scalability to handle large volumes of data and complex automation processes.

Python and RPA Bots for Policy Issuance Automation

Python is a versatile programming language that plays a crucial role in policy issuance automation. It enables the development of both unattended and attended bots that streamline various tasks in the policy issuance process:

a. Unattended Bots:

Unattended bots are automated scripts that run in the background without human intervention. They can be used for tasks such as:

  • Extracting data from insurance applications and other documents
  • Validating data for accuracy and completeness
  • Generating policy documents
  • Sending notifications and updates to customers and agents

b. Attended Bots:

Attended bots, on the other hand, require human interaction to complete tasks. They assist insurance agents by providing real-time guidance and automating repetitive tasks. This can significantly enhance productivity and reduce errors.

Cloud Platforms for Orchestration and Scalability

Cloud platforms offer robust automation orchestration capabilities that go beyond traditional RPA/workflow tools. They provide:

  • Scalability: Cloud platforms can handle large volumes of data and complex automation processes, making them ideal for enterprise-scale policy issuance automation.
  • Integration: Cloud platforms seamlessly integrate with various insurance systems and applications, enabling end-to-end automation.
  • Advanced Features: Cloud platforms offer advanced features such as machine learning, AI, and analytics capabilities, which can further enhance the efficiency and accuracy of policy issuance automation.

AI for Accuracy and Edge-Case Handling

AI plays a vital role in improving the accuracy and handling edge cases in policy issuance automation. AI techniques such as:

  • Image recognition: Can automate the extraction of data from scanned documents and images, reducing manual effort and errors.
  • Natural language processing (NLP): Can analyze unstructured text data, such as customer emails or chat transcripts, to extract relevant information and automate decision-making.
  • Generative AI: Can assist in generating personalized policy documents and recommendations based on customer data and preferences.

Sub-Processes and Automation with Python and Cloud

Policy Issuance Automation involves several sub-processes that can be automated using Python and cloud platforms:

  1. Data Extraction: Python can automate the extraction of data from insurance applications, scanned documents, and other sources. Cloud platforms provide OCR (Optical Character Recognition) services to assist in extracting data from images.
  2. Data Validation: Python scripts can validate data for accuracy and completeness, ensuring that all required information is present and correct. Cloud platforms offer data validation tools and services to enhance the accuracy of the validation process.
  3. Document Generation: Python can generate policy documents based on extracted data and pre-defined templates. Cloud platforms provide document generation services that can automate the creation of personalized and compliant policy documents.
  4. Notifications and Updates: Python scripts can send automated notifications and updates to customers and agents regarding the status of policy issuance. Cloud platforms offer messaging and notification services to facilitate real-time communication.

Data Security and Compliance

Data security and compliance are paramount in the insurance industry. Python and cloud platforms provide robust security measures to protect sensitive customer data. Cloud platforms offer encryption, access controls, and compliance certifications to ensure that data is handled securely and in accordance with industry regulations.

The Future of Policy Issuance Automation

The future of policy issuance automation holds exciting possibilities for further enhancements and integration with emerging technologies:

  • AI and Machine Learning: Advanced AI and machine learning algorithms can automate complex underwriting decisions, risk assessment, and fraud detection.
  • Blockchain: Blockchain technology can provide a secure and transparent platform for storing and managing policy data, enabling real-time policy issuance and tracking.
  • Internet of Things (IoT): IoT devices can collect data from sensors and devices to provide real-time insights into risk factors, enabling personalized and usage-based insurance policies.
